on 10/24/00 6:48 PM, Richard Crane at [EMAIL PROTECTED] wrote: > Problem is a disparity is detected and reported, and one of the two mirror > components > rejected when the system boots ( don't have the exact message at hand), and > so the > re-sync doesn't happen because there is only one disk in the raid device. Have you tried a raidhotadd?: raidhotadd /dev/raiddevice0 /dev/harddrivepartition3 When I lost a drive on one of my RAID machines after I replaced and repartitioned the new drive I had to manually add each partition back into the raid. That resynched them as well. -- Darron [EMAIL PROTECTED] - To unsubscribe from this list: send the line "unsubscribe linux-raid" in the body of a message to [EMAIL PROTECTED]
